Somera Communications Signs First Lifecycle Management Services Agreement in Asia Pacific Region

DALLAS, Aug. 4 /PRNewswire-FirstCall/ -- Somera Communications (NASDAQ:SMRA), a global provider of telecommunications asset management and recovery services, today announced the signing of a multi-million dollar Lifecycle Management Services agreement with S.A. Telecom System Ltd., a leading wireless carrier in Bangladesh. This relationship represents Somera's first services agreement with a carrier in the Asia Pacific region. S.A. Telecom is in the process of deploying a wireless network in the southeastern region of Bangladesh, and has engaged Somera to provide ancillary equipment and services to complement the primary CDMA equipment being furnished by a major telecom OEM. Under this program, which is scheduled to be implemented over an 18-month timeframe, Somera will be responsible for the provisioning of equipment, installation, testing, site specifications, training, spares, and the overall successful operation of its portion of the network. "We chose Somera to recommend CDMA infrastructure and also cost-effectively source, deploy and manage ancillary equipment for our network on a turnkey basis," said Md. Shahabuddin Alam, Managing Director of S.A. Telecom. "Having expertise with end-to-end network equipment from over 350 telecom manufacturers and repair/spares capabilities for over 40,000 products from more than 50 manufacturers, Somera provided us with a vendor-agnostic opinion for sourcing the telecom infrastructure while ensuring industry-leading price-performance. We are confident that leveraging Somera's capabilities will allow us to rapidly deploy, operate and maintain our network cost-effectively." "We are very pleased to assist S.A. Telecom in the buildout of a wireless network that will cover a population of approximately 50 million subscribers," said David W. Heard, Somera's President and Chief Executive Officer. "Our ability to provide turnkey auxiliary services and deliver meaningful cost savings by using a vendor-agnostic asset manager made us uniquely suited to win this project. We are optimistic that we will demonstrate significant value to S.A. Telecom during the initial buildout phase and convert this relationship into a longer-term contract covering the ongoing management of their network assets. "We continue to make steady progress in the ramp-up of our services business and add more annuity-based revenue to our business mix. S.A. Telecom represents the first international carrier to engage our new services, and is a direct result of our efforts to increase our presence in key markets such as the Asia Pacific region. In the past few months, we have added highly seasoned telecom veterans Sanjay Vidyarthi and Donald Brown to oversee our Asia Pacific operations, and their strong relationships in the region are helping to build a solid pipeline of new business opportunities for Somera," said Mr. Heard. Sanjay Vidyarthi has been appointed Somera's Managing Director for the Asia Pacific region. Mr. Vidyarthi has more than 18 years experience in telecommunications having worked in Asia, Europe and the United States. He previously served as Chief Operating Officer for Tekelec's operations in India and held a number of senior marketing and technical positions at Lucent Technologies. Donald Brown has been appointed Director of Business Operations for the Asia Pacific region. Mr. Brown has more than 30 years of telecommunications experience including senior management positions in sales, marketing, implementation and customer support with AT&T/Lucent Technologies and most recently Tekelec. The majority of Mr. Brown's experience has been in various positions in the Far East as part of AT&T/Lucent's highly successful globalization of its switching and wireless product lines. About Somera Somera launched its family of Lifecycle Management Services in 2004 in response to an industry-wide need for telecom asset management to optimize return on assets. Somera's product offerings enable service providers to generate greater value from legacy assets in the form of lower operating costs, longer product life, higher productivity, and real measurable capital savings. With Somera LifecyclePLUS, customers can outsource elements of network operations, logistics, and technical service. Somera RecoveryPLUS(TM) is a program approach to deliver documented savings and expense relief by recovering hidden value in current underutilized assets and inventories. Somera RepairPLUS provides comprehensive support for wireless, wireline, and data products at significant savings and reduced cycle times. These services are in addition to Somera's traditional Brokerage business that provides immediate availability of quality, warranted new and refurbished equipment at savings of 25 to 60%. Founded in 1995, Somera has developed an impressive base of over 1,100 customers worldwide, including the industry leaders from each segment of the telecommunications market.
